When I first saw these I was excited to find a shoe that would keep my feet dry and warm on slushy/rainy days. I ordered them and wore them right away. They aren't the most comfortable Uggs but seemed like they would break in within a day or two. The first time I wore them, I was prepared to write a raving review. My feet were dry and warm. I wore them again the next day and noticed that my feet were wet. On the side of my feet, my socks were soaked through. I thought maybe some snow got in from the top so I let them dry out and tried again. Same thing. Wet socks and feet. I called Ugg and they said I could send them back to Ugg at my expense to have them "evaluated.". Which means that if they say they leak, then I get a new pair. If they decide they don't leak, I get to keep the defective pair. How's that for customer service! So, I boxed them up, returned them Zappos, no questions asked, and ordered a different shoe. Ugg has been a long time favorite and I've owned several different styles over the years and have always been happy. I have shoes that have lasted 4 years being used for work 3 days a week. That speaks to the quality. Pass on these. They are cuter than traditional duck shoes but just don't work well.
